What happens when one moment stays with you for years? We remember the meeting, the words, the room and exactly how we felt. Even years later, one comment can still influence how we see ourselves and what we believe is possible.

Listen in to host Natalie Benamou share a story she heard at the FQ Lounge in Chicago by Shelley Zalis, CEO, The Female Quotient. From negative feedback to a career-making win, this episode explores why some experiences are rose moments and others are thorns.

Find out the three steps to take in the moment, and find joy. Special thanks to Beth Grimm for the Rose and Thorn idea.

3 Ways to Reframe Any Situation

Celebrate something about yourself. 

Celebrate someone else and pay it forward.

Celebrate one thing to look forward to in the future.

About Natalie Benamou

Natalie Benamou is the Founder of HerCsuite® and Board President and CEO of HER HEALTHX, a nonprofit improving women’s health outcomes by bridging the care communication gap. Natalie is a speaker and bestselling author. Learn more about Natalie Benamou Speaking here.
